PHP Świadectwo tymczasowe dla akcjonariusza open_basedir Ograniczenie w Wykonywać Błąd
PHP open_basedir zabezpieczenie uszczypnąć jest pewniak przy zakładzie Tryb zabezpieczenie miara ów zapobiega użytkownik z otwór akta albo świadectwo tymczasowe dla akcjonariusza umieszczony zewnątrz od ich katalog macierzysty rezygnować PHP, jeżeli nie ten teczka ma wyraźnie dzień wyłączony ze świadczeń. PHP open_basedir osiedlać jeśli umożliwiał, wola zapewnić ów wszystko umieścić w teczce z dokumentami operacje zostać spółka z ograniczoną odpowiedzialnością wobec akta wobec pewny księga adresowa, i tak zapobiegać php świadectwo tymczasowe dla akcjonariusza pod kątem pewien szczególny użytkownik z dostępując akta w nieupoważnione użytkownik’ uważać. Podczas pewien świadectwo tymczasowe dla akcjonariusza próbuje wobec otworzyć segregator rezygnować, na przykład, fopen() albo gzopen(), ten określenie miejsca od ten umieścić w teczce z dokumentami jest kontroler. Podczas ten umieścić w teczce z dokumentami jest zewnątrz ten sporządzić specyfikacje albo dozwolony księga adresowa- drzewo, PHP wola odrzucić wobec otworzyć ono i ten kolejne błędy maj trafiać się:
przestroga file_exists() [function.file- istnieje]: open_basedir ograniczenie w wykonywać. Umieścić w teczce z dokumentami(/ ognisko domowe/user_name/public_html/wp- nawiązywać kontakt/ wyślij pliki/2006/12/picture.jpg) nie jest rezygnować ten dozwolony ścieżki(): (/ognisko domowe/user_name:/usr/ liberalizm/php:/usr/ miejscowy/ liberalizm/php:/tmp) w ognisko domowe/user_name/public_html/wp- administrator/ przy życiu-uploading.php u specjalność 226
Ten powyższy błąd przekaz ukazuje się u pewien Apasz httpd tkanina serwer błąd raport (error_log) wrogi Wordpress blog. Jednakże, ten problem maj zdarzyć się wobec wszystko system albo websites ów używać PHP równie rękopis język.
Ten roztwór albo workaround wobec open_basedir ograniczenie problem jest ów uczynić kaleką ten PHP open_basedir zabezpieczenie całkowicie, albo wobec wyłączać ten zabezpieczenie na pewno uprzywilejował użytkownik zestawienie rachunkowe, albo wobec uznawać dostęp do dodatkowy księga adresowa pod kątem PHP świadectwo tymczasowe dla akcjonariusza.
Jeśli twój’ przy pomocy cPanel WebHost Dyrektor (WHM), możesz łatwo uczynić kaleką PHP open_basedir zabezpieczenie albo wyłączać pewny użytkownik z zabezpieczenie rezygnować WHM. Zwykłe iść do “ uszczypnąć Zabezpieczenie” wobec ten “ zabezpieczenie” rozcinanie, wtedy wybierać “ konfigurować” ogniwo pod kątem “Php open_basedir Uszczypnąć”. Wnętrze ono, możesz umożliwiać albo uczynić kaleką php open_basedir Zabezpieczenie, albo wyłączać i zawierać gospodarze z zabezpieczenie.
Jeśli twój’ przy pomocy Plesewo wrogi tablica kontrolna, możesz potrzebować wobec zręcznie wydawać Apasz konfiguracja umieścić w teczce z dokumentami od vhost.conf i vhost_ssl.conf, i włączać albo wydawać ten kolejne php_admin_value open_basedir linie do kolejne:
<księga adresowa pełny/ ścieżka/ wobec/ ten/ księga adresowa/httpdocs>
/
php_admin_value open_basedir nikt
</Księga adresowa>
<księga adresowa pełny/ ścieżka/ wobec/ ten/ księga adresowa/httpdocs>
/
php_admin_value open_basedir pełny/ ścieżka/ wobec/dir:/ pełny/ ścieżka/ wobec/ księga adresowa/httpdocs:/tmp
/
</Księga adresowa>
skrypt dłużny Pod kątem SSL gospodarze w ten vhost_ssl.conf umieścić w teczce z dokumentami, ten Księga adresowa ścieżka wola kończyć rezygnować “httpsdocs” zamiast czegoś “httpdocs”.
Ten ścieżki ( powyższy jest przykład tylko i zostać wymienione rezygnować rzeczywisty ścieżka) ów z tyłu open_basedir jesteście ten kierowniczy ów wyraźnie dozwolony pod kątem ten PHP świadectwo tymczasowe dla akcjonariusza w ten vhost posiadłości uważać wobec dostęp, tak możesz włączać liczniejszy kierowniczy ów akta jesteście był zmagazynowany i potrzebny zostać otwarty przy PHP, każdy seperated przy kolor“:”. Oprócz uważać równie ono mogą wywóz twój system wobec zabezpieczenie oszustwo.
Skoro sporządzony, biegać ten rozkazywać poniżej wobec zrobić ten zmiany skuteczny, a następnie odnawiać zapas towarów Apasz httpd tkanina serwer (apache2ctl odnawiać zapas towarów albo httpd odnawiać zapas towarów):
$PRODUCT_ROOT_D/ administrator/sbin/websrvmng v pewien
Jeśli masz wobec zręcznie wydawać ten Apasz konfiguracja umieścić w teczce z dokumentami wobec uczynić kaleką PHP open_basedir zabezpieczenie, zwykłe otworzyć się ten httpd.conf umieścić w teczce z dokumentami, i zrewidować pod kątem ten linie ów wzdryga się rezygnować ten kolejne litery:
php_admin_value open_basedir …..
Wymienić całe specjalność wobec ten czynny zastęp pod kątem ten posiadłości użytkownik uważać ów ty potrzeba wobec uczynić kaleką zabezpieczenie rezygnować ten kolejne specjalność wobec uczynić kaleką ono:
php_admin_value open_basedir nikt
Możesz także optować biorąc pod uwagę twój PHP świadectwo tymczasowe dla akcjonariusza wobec dostęp dodatkowy księga adresowa zamiast rezygnować czyniący niezdolnym ten zabezpieczenie. Dodatkowy księga adresowa mogą być dodatkowy do specjalność, oddzielony rezygnować kolor“:”. Na przykład, wobec dodać new_directory do uznawać lista:
php_admin_value open_basedir “/ ognisko domowe/user_account/:/usr/ liberalizm/php:/usr/ miejscowy/ liberalizm/php:/tmp”
php_admin_value open_basedir “/ ognisko domowe/user_account/:/usr/ liberalizm/php:/usr/ miejscowy/ liberalizm/php:/tmp:/new_directory”
Odnawiać zapas towarów ten Apasz za gotowy redagowanie. Skrypt dłużny ów ten księga adresowa dozwolony lista ograniczenie powyższy jest rzeczywiście pewien umieszczać na przedzie, nie jeden księga adresowa wymienić. Ten oznacza ów “open_basedir = dir/incl” także pozwala dostęp wobec “/dir/ zawierać” i “/dir/incls” jeśli oni istnieć. Podczas ty potrzeba wobec ograniczać dostęp wobec tylko ten sporządzić specyfikacje księga adresowa, kończyć rezygnować pewien ciąć. Na przykład: “open_basedir = dir/incl/”.
/import: To jest maszyna przetłumaczony stronica który jest zaopatrzony " równie jest" rezygnować gwarancja. Tłumaczenie maszynowe maj być trudny wobec rozumieć. Podobać się odsyłać wobecpierwotny Język angielski przedmiot kiedykolwiek możliwy.
Udział i przyczyniać się albo dostać techniczny poprzeć i współpracownik przyMój Cyfrowy Życie Forum.
Pokrewny Przedmioty
- PHP Analizować zdanie Błąd: składnia błąd, niespodziewany $ kończyć
- PHP Dozwolony Pamięć Rozmiar Exchausted Błąd katastroficzny
- PHP 5 Niesłabnący wobec Otworzyć HTTP Prośba Potok rezygnować fopen albo fsockopen Funkcja
- Rata XCache PHP Akcelerator w Linux przy Kompilujący z Źródło
- WordPress MySQL SQL Zapytanie Błąd w WPDB Klasyfikować
- gmmktime Błąd w WordPress i Sroka
- Poczta elektroniczna Odskakuje W tył rezygnować “unrouteable poczta posiadłości” Błąd
- Wyrocznia Baza danych Importować Błąd 3113/3114
- RapidLeech v2.2 Wolny Wprowadzić do komputera dane za pomocą sieci telefonicznej
- Jak wobec Wykonać na zamówienie, Modyfikować albo Zmieniać WordPress Baza danych Połączenie Błąd Stronica

































Grudzień 3rd, 2007 1621:
[...] querĂ©is más informaciĂłn trzeźwość szanować tema, siano un artĂculo muy interesante trzeźwość szanować błąd en Mój Cyfrowy Życie. etykieta Desarrollo, wrogi, open_basedir, [...]
Grudzień 21st, 2007 1658:
Wielki przedmiot.
Dzięki pod kątem ten WHM koniuszek.
Ty uratowany o kurde.